Online Real Estate Auction
Online property auctions follow the same logic as in-person auctions, but are held on specialized digital platforms. Anyone can bid from wherever they are.
Properties are made available at an initial price, and interested parties place bids. The highest bid within the established deadline wins the property.
To enter the auction, you must register on the platform and analyze the notice, which contains important details about the property and the rules of the dispute.
Additionally, some platforms require a security deposit to validate participation. This ensures that only genuinely interested buyers place bids.

Real Estate Auction
A judicial auction takes place when the court orders the sale of a property, generally to settle outstanding debts owed by the previous owner.
These auctions are organized by courts and follow strict rules. The properties may come from tax enforcement, seizure or bankruptcy proceedings.
Prices are usually attractive, since the goal is to settle the debt. However, it is essential to check all the information in the notice before placing a bid.
In online property auctions, the rules remain the same. The difference is that the entire process takes place digitally, making participation more accessible and practical.
Extrajudicial Real Estate Auction
The extrajudicial auction takes place without judicial intervention, and is common in cases of properties repossessed by banks due to default on financing.
In this case, financial institutions organize the auction to recover the amount invested in the financing, selling the property to new buyers.
Deadlines are usually shorter and less bureaucratic. This makes the process faster, ideal for those looking for a more agile negotiation.
Additionally, many banks conduct online property auctions, allowing buyers to bid from anywhere and follow the entire process virtually.

Property Valuation Before Auction
Before bidding, it is essential to analyze the condition of the property. Photos can be misleading, and an inspection can prevent unexpected renovation costs.
If possible, visit the site or hire an expert to assess the structure. Minor repairs are normal, but structural problems can require a large investment.
When auctioning a property online, check the information in the notice and the description of the property. This information helps you better understand its real condition.
Additionally, research the market value of the area. This allows you to compare prices and see if the discount offered at the auction is really worth it.
How to Check the Regularity of a Property
In addition to the physical condition, it is essential to ensure that the property is legally regularized. Debts related to taxes and condominium fees may be passed on to the new owner.
Checking the property registration at the property registry office reveals whether there are any pending legal issues. This step prevents the purchase of a property with hidden problems.
In online property auctions, the notice provides information about possible charges and restrictions. Reading this document carefully will help you avoid unexpected costs in the future.
If you have any doubts, hiring a specialized lawyer can be a good decision. They will ensure that all legal aspects are in order before the purchase.
Expenses for the Auction of the Property
Upon winning an auction, the buyer must pay the bid amount and other expenses specified in the notice. This cost may vary depending on the type of auction.
In online property auctions, some platforms require a deposit before the purchase is finalized. This amount can be deducted from the final payment for the property.
Furthermore, in some cases, there is a need to pay the auctioneer's fees, which generally correspond to a percentage of the auctioned value.
Another essential factor to consider is the possible costs of vacating the property, if it is still occupied by the previous owner or a tenant.
Auction Related Taxes and Fees
After purchasing the property, the buyer must pay mandatory taxes required by the municipality when transferring ownership.
There are also notary fees, such as registering the property and noting the new owner in the property registry, which are essential to guarantee legal possession.
In online property auctions, some platforms already include estimates of these costs in the notice. Checking this information avoids surprises and helps with financial planning.
Finally, it is worth remembering that, depending on the property, there may be outstanding condominium fees. These amounts often need to be paid by the new owner.
